Teen Arrested in Deadly Park Brawl

About this episode

Joel Michael Gamble-Toliver, 18, faces charges for a deadly brawl at Leinbach Park, leaving two teens dead and five injured. Hes accused of firing shots, and is charged with felony child abuse and felony riot. Witnesses or tipsters can contact Winston-Salem police or Crime Stoppers for anonymous information.

Police in Winston-Salem, nabbed an 18-year-old named Joel Michael Gamble-Tolliver on Tuesday for jumping into a pre-plan fight at Line-Buff Park. That turned deadly. The Monday brawl ended with him firing shots, leaving two teenagers dead in five others injured, all between 14 and 19 years old. He's basing felony child abuse and felony riot charges, plus a separate warrant for possessing a stolen gun. This all kicked off when Gamble-Tolliver showed up expecting a scrap, then dove right into the chaos with one of the teens. Cops say the scene was massive because so many folks were tangled up in it. The child abuse charge hits hearts as it covers adults who recklessly endanger kids under 16, leading to serious harm. Chief William H. Penn Jr. made it clear, grown-ups fueling youth fights through hype or just watching will face charges, no exceptions. It's still unclear if Gamble-Tolliver's bullets struck any victims amid the frenzy.
